Primary Responsibilities
As a Compliance Officer in Guinea, your primary responsibility will be to develop, implement, and oversee compliance programs, policies, and procedures to guarantee adherence to legal and regulatory requirements. Your work will involve conducting audits, assessments, and training to promote compliance awareness and foster a culture of integrity and accountability within the organization.
Key Responsibilities
- Develop, implement, and maintain compliance programs, policies, and procedures to ensure adherence to relevant laws, regulations, and industry standards.
- Monitor and assess regulatory changes, emerging risks, and industry trends to identify potential compliance issues and recommend appropriate actions.
- Conduct compliance risk assessments and audits to evaluate the effectiveness of controls and identify areas for improvement.
- Investigate allegations of non-compliance, fraud, misconduct, or unethical behavior, and recommend corrective actions and preventive measures.
- Provide guidance and advice to employees on compliance matters, including regulatory requirements, company policies, and ethical standards.
- Develop and deliver compliance training programs and materials to educate employees on their responsibilities and promote awareness of compliance obligations.
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ree in business, law, finance, or a related field; advanced degree or professional certifications in compliance may be preferred.
- Proven experience in compliance, risk management, internal audit, or regulatory affairs roles.
- Strong understanding of relevant laws, regulations, and industry standards applicable to the organization’s operations.
- Knowledge of compliance frameworks, methodologies, and best practices.
